The Iowa Core (formerly known as the Iowa Core Curriculum and the Model Core Curriculum) provides academic expectations for all of Iowa's K-12 students. The site provides educators a well-researched set of standards in literacy and mathematics and essential concepts and skills in science, social studies, and 21st century learning (civic literacy, financial literacy, technology literacy, health literacy, and employability skills). It identifies the essential content and instruction of critical content areas that all students must experience.
The Iowa Core project will commence this month (April, 2014). Promet Source will build the Iowa Core website with strong UI/UX, improved access to curriculum and resources, improved social features, strong SEO configuration, and a strategy for future content creation. Further, the site will be created with a responsive design; the site will adjust fluidly between desktop, mobile and tablet. Additionally, Promet will develop a site adhering to best practices in website architecture, navigation and front end design.
Promet Source plans to give an innovative user experience both for educators utilizing Iowa Core and for those creating and maintaining content & resources on the site. The site shall address the different needs of different users; it will be designed around personas with special attention to UI/UX and navigation.
The new Iowa Core website will be built in Drupal, an open source CMS. Custom modules will be created and implemented to support the Iowa Department of Education’s needs. Promet Source will provide different means for the Iowa Core to showcase their resources: model curriculum, resource links to instructional materials, scope & sequence documents, professional learning resources, and more. To support future growth of the site, Promet will develop dynamic content types and templates to replace static content (e.g. PDFs and word documents).
Promet Source will launch the new site by July, 2014.
